Abstract
Clock extraction from an optically or electrically injected 223 − 1 PRBS RZ data signal in a two-section ridge waveguide DFB laser with a new type of selfpulsation is demonstrated between 0.4 and 0.7 GHz. A locking range of 50 MHz is measured.Keywords
